Festo EMMB-AS Series Servo Motor, 0.96 Nm Maximum Output Torque, 6000 rpm Output Speed - EMMB-AS-40-01-S30M, Numeric Part Number: 8097167


This servo motor is designed for precision applications in automation and industrial processes. With a Compact form factor of 116.6mm in length, 45mm in width, and 70mm in depth, it provides high performance in a small package. The motor operates at a supply voltage of 300V, with a maximum output torque of 0.96 Nm and an impressive output speed of 6000 rpm, making it suitable for demanding tasks.

How does the torque performance enhance application efficiency?


The motor provides a maximum output torque of 0.96 Nm, which allows it to handle demanding applications smoothly. This high torque capability reduces the risk of motor stalls, ensuring continuous operation even under load.

What are the implications of the low rotor inertia in practical use?


With a rotor inertia of 0.059kg.cm², the servo motor responds quickly to control signals. This benefit is Crucial in systems where precise movements and Rapid acceleration or deceleration are required for accurate task execution.

What advantages do the Compact dimensions bring for integration?


Its Compact size of 116.6mm by 45mm by 70mm allows for easy integration into various equipment configurations. This feature enables use in tight spaces without compromising on performance.
